Inkcazo

I-Molecular sieve dehydration skid sisixhobo esiphambili sokucoca igesi yendalo okanye ukulungiswa kwegesi yendalo. I-molecular sieve yikristale ye-alkali yensimbi ye-aluminosilicate enesakhiwo sesakhelo kunye nesakhiwo esifanayo se-microporous. Xa igesi yokutya equkethe amanzi okulandelela idlula kwi-molecular sieve bed kwiqondo lokushisa, i-trace water kunye ne-mercaptan iyaxutywa, ngaloo ndlela inciphisa umthamo wamanzi kunye ne-mercaptan kwigesi yokutya, iqonda injongo yokuphelelwa ngamanzi kunye ne-desulfurization. inkqubo ye-adsorption ye-molecular sieve idla ngokuqhutyelwa kwiqondo lokushisa eliphantsi kunye noxinzelelo oluphezulu, ngelixa ukuvuselelwa kwe-desorption kuqhutyelwa kwiqondo lokushisa eliphezulu kunye noxinzelelo oluphantsi. Ngaphantsi kwesenzo sobushushu obuphezulu, igesi ecocekileyo kunye noxinzelelo oluphantsi lokuvuselela igesi, i-molecular sieve adsorbent ikhupha i-adsorbate kwi-micropore kwi-regeneration gas flow de isixa se-adsorbate kwi-adsorbent sifikelele kwinqanaba eliphantsi kakhulu, kwaye inamandla okufunxa amanzi kunye ne-mercaptan kwigesi yokutya, ukuqonda inkqubo yokuhlaziywa kwe-molecular kunye ne-recycling process.
Indlela ye-molecular sieve luhlobo lwendlela yokuphelelwa ngamanzi emzimbeni, ehlala isetyenziswa kwinkqubo yokwahlula i-condensation yobushushu obuphantsi, njenge-natural gas condensate (NGL) yokubuyisela kunye nenkqubo yokukhutshwa kwamanzi ekuveliseni i-liquefied natural gas (LNG). Ukongeza, i-molecular sieve dehydration iphinda isetyenziswe ekuveliseni igesi yendalo ecinezelweyo kumafutha emoto.

Ukukhutshwa kwe-molecular sieve dehydration ngokuqhelekileyo kusebenza kwezi zihlandlo zilandelayo:
a. Apho umbethe werhasi yendalo kufuneka ube ngaphantsi kwe -40 ℃.
b. Ilungele ulawulo lwe-hydrocarbon dew point yegesi yendalo enoxinzelelo oluphezulu.
c. Igesi yendalo iphelelwe ngamanzi kwaye ihlanjululwe ngexesha elifanayo.
d. Xa igesi yendalo equkethe i-H2S iphelelwe ngamanzi kwaye ichithwe kwi-glycol, iya kubangela ukukhutshwa kwegesi yokuvuselela.
e. Xa i-LPG kunye ne-NGL i-dehydration kufuneka isuse i-trace sulfide (H2S, CO, COS, CS2, mercaptan) ngexesha elifanayo.

Itshathi equkuqelayo

I-adsorbers yebhedi esisigxina isetyenziselwa ukuchithwa kwe-molecular sieve dehydration, ngoko ke iyunithi kufuneka ibe nee-adsorbers ezimbini, enye ikwinqanaba le-adsorption dehydration, enye ikwinqanaba lokuhlaziya kunye nokupholisa. Xa umthamo weyunithi umkhulu kakhulu, inkqubo ye-multi tower nayo inokulungiswa.
